π£ New WP in #economics
π βClimate Regulation & Civil Society Activismβ
By M. Limardi, @jordanloper.bsky.social & @avolle.bsky.social π·οΈ
Evidence from 75 countries (2010β2022) shows that public #climateregulation amplifies #activism rather than crowding it out.

Just published in @jpube.bsky.social:
"Present bias in politics and self-committing treaties"
By @bardharstad.bsky.social & Anke Kessler

New updated slides deck about Local Projections Difference-in-Differences (LP-DiD)
LP-DiD is a fast and simple to implement regression-based framework for estimating DiD, which can reproduce popular recent estimators as specific instances.

Version 2.0 of the National Elections Database is online! nationalelectionsdatabase.com
We cover presidential and parliamentary elections 1789β2023, extending the post-1945 data of Electoral Turnovers @reveconstudies.bsky.social (academic.oup.com/restud/advan...)
